Transaction

e56600daaefdf50b5c6bc9ef2d02e466b4c9edbbc51dbacfbbe3237eba89e03e
150,373 confirmations
Timestamp
1679558130
Block782,096
Fee19,711 sats
Fee rate22 sats/vB
view on mempool.space

Inputs & Outputs